Deficiency record · 1

05 - Radio Communications › N/A - No Subsystem › INMARSAT ship earth station
Issued 6 February 2021 Resolved
Every ship shall be provided with radio installations capable of complying with the functional requirements prescribed by regulation 4 throughout its intended voyage. PSCO observed inmarsat-C ubable to receive and transmit following a lightning strike on 11FEB21 that damaged the antenna. provide technician report attesting to satisfactory operation of inmarsat-c.
Condition: Damaged By Earlier Event
Action required: 17 - Rectify deficiencies prior to departure
Due 12 March 2021
Resolved 25 February 2021
Resolution: Recieved NKK class report. Installed a new Jue-87 antenna, secured the cable, and weather proofed outside connections. Made connection w/ GMDSS console. System receiving ECG's. Sat-C is fully operational.
